Unit 1 Vocabulary
2
adjacent(ad-jac-ent)
  • definition (adj) near to
  • My house is adjacent to my neighbors house.

3
alight(a light)
  • 1.)(v)means to land, to come down from
  • Did you see the bird alight on the branch?
  • 2.)(adj) means made bright by
  • The discarded match was alight.

4
barren(bar-ren)
  • Means not productive, bare (adj)
  • The land was barren because nothing would grow.

5
disrupt(dis-rupt)
  • Means to break up, disturb (v)
  • The toddler was able to disrupt his whole
    family with all the racket he made.

6
dynasty(dy na sty)
  • Definition ( n) A powerful family or group of
    rulers that maintains its position or power for
    some time.
  • The Ming Dynasty is in China

7
foretaste(fore taste)
  • Definition ( n) An advance indication, sample,
    warning
  • Seeing the dandelions in the yard gave the boys a
    foretaste of spring weather.

8
germinate(ger mi nate)
  • Definition -To begin to grow (v)
  • Can you see that the seeds are beginning to
    germinate?

9
humdrum(hum drum)
  • Definition (adj) Ordinary, dull routine, boring
  • This man finds his paperwork to be very humdrum.
  • .

10
hurtle(hur tle)
  • Means to rush violently (v)
  • The rocket began to hurtle through space.

11
insinuate( in sin u ate)
  • Definition to suggest or hint slyly (v)
  • Did your teacher insinuate that your homework
    excuse was untruthful?

12
interminable(in ter mi na ble)
  • Definition means endless or so long to seem
    endless (adj)
  • The children thought the car ride to Wisconsin
    was interminable.

13
interrogate(in ter ro gate)
  • Definition (v) to ask questions
  • The officer was beginning to interrogate the
    suspect.

14
recompense(rec om pense)
  • Definition (v) to pay back to give an award
    (n) a payment for loss, service or injury.
  • The homeowner was happy to recompense the teen
    for painting his fence.

15
renovate(ren o vate)
  • Definition (v) to repair, restore to good
    condition, make new again
  • The family hired a contractor to help them
    renovate their home.

16
resume( res u me)
  • Definition (n) a brief summary a short written
    account of ones education, working experience,
    or qualifications for a job.
  • The young man gave a copy of his resume to the
    employer.

17
sullen(sul len)
  • Definition (adj) anger or resentment, silently
    brooding
  • The boy was sullen because his dog ran away.

18
trickle(trick le)
  • Definition- (v) to fall by drops (n) a small
    quantity of anything
  • The water began to trickle from the faucet.

19
trivial(triv i al)
  • Definition- (adj) not important, minor
  • Trivial Pursuit is the name of a game that asks
    questions about trivial matters.

20
truce
  • Definition (n) a pause in fighting, temporary
    peace
  • The commander ordered a truce for the holidays.

21
vicious(vic ious)
  • Definition (adj) evil, bad
  • The vicious dog was not allowed to come by the
    children.
